Introduction to Wonder Man

Wonder Man, a superhero in the Marvel Comics universe, first appeared in ‘Avengers’ #9 in 1964. Created by writer Stan Lee and artist Don Heck, he has become a notable character due to his complex history and unique powers. As Marvel continues to expand its cinematic and comic universe, Wonder Man’s role is becoming increasingly relevant, appealing to new fans while maintaining a loyal existing following.

Character Overview

Wonder Man, whose real name is Simon Williams, is often depicted as an antagonist-turned-ally of the Avengers. Originally created as a villain to combat the Avengers, Williams gains ionic superpowers after an experiment with his father’s company. This transformation grants him superhuman strength, speed, and the ability to fly, which sets him apart from other characters in the Marvel canon.

Connection to Other Marvel Characters

Wonder Man has strong ties to several key figures in the Marvel universe. His relationship with the Avengers, especially his dynamic with characters like Vision and Scarlet Witch, is both complex and pivotal. Additionally, his friendship with other superheroes like Thor and the Hulk often brings about emotional and moral dilemmas, showcasing the broader themes of heroism and vulnerability in Marvel stories.
